Method 1: Using the sizeof Operator
The sizeof operator is a built-in function in C that returns the size of a variable or data type. However, it returns the size of the entire object, not just the array. To find the length of an array, you need to use the sizeof operator with the sizeof operator again, like this:
#include <stdio.h>
int main() {
int arr[5] = {1, 2, 3, 4, 5};
int length = sizeof(arr) / sizeof(arr[0]);
printf("Length of array: %dn", length);
return 0;
}
In this example, sizeof(arr) / sizeof(arr[0]) calculates the length of the array by dividing the total size of the array by the size of each element. The result is the number of elements in the array.
